甲醇燃料汽车加注基础设施建设现状与发展对策
Current status and development strategies of methanol fuel vehicle refueling infrastructure
发展甲醇燃料汽车是我国推动交通能源多元化的重要战略举措,也是促进绿色生产生活方式转型的关键抓手,其规模化推广的成效,在很大程度上取决于甲醇燃料加注基础设施的完善程度。系统梳理了推动甲醇燃料汽车加注基础设施建设的相关政策,分析了国内车用甲醇燃料加注站建设现状和区域分布特点,探讨了当前面临的加注网络覆盖不足、工程建设标准体系尚不完善、市场认知度偏低等主要挑战,并从完善基础设施布局、健全标准规范体系、加大政策支持力度、加强市场推广与宣传教育等方面,提出了相应的对策建议。
The development of methanol-fueled vehicles constitutes an integral component of China’s diversification strategy for transportation energy and serves as a critical driver for accelerating the transition toward green production and lifestyles.Their widespread adoption largely depends on the improvement of methanol refueling infrastructure.This study systematically reviews policies aimed at promoting the construction of methanol refueling infrastructure,analyzes the current status and regional distribution characteristics of vehicle methanol refueling stations in China,and examines key challenges such as inadequate coverage of the refueling network,incomplete engineering standards,and low market awareness.Corresponding recommendations are proposed from the perspectives of infrastructure enhancement,standardization,policy support,and market promotion.
